def merge_insert(self, on: Union[str, Iterable[str]]) -> LanceMergeInsertBuilder:
|
||||
"""
|
||||
Returns a [`LanceMergeInsertBuilder`][lancedb.merge.LanceMergeInsertBuilder]
|
||||
that can be used to create a "merge insert" operation
|
||||
|
||||
This operation can add rows, update rows, and remove rows all in a single
|
||||
transaction. It is a very generic tool that can be used to create
|
||||
behaviors like "insert if not exists", "update or insert (i.e. upsert)",
|
||||
or even replace a portion of existing data with new data (e.g. replace
|
||||
all data where month="january")
|
||||
|
||||
The merge insert operation works by combining new data from a
|
||||
**source table** with existing data in a **target table** by using a
|
||||
join. There are three categories of records.
|
||||
|
||||
"Matched" records are records that exist in both the source table and
|
||||
the target table. "Not matched" records exist only in the source table
|
||||
(e.g. these are new data) "Not matched by source" records exist only
|
||||
in the target table (this is old data)
|
||||
|
||||
The builder returned by this method can be used to customize what
|
||||
should happen for each category of data.
|
||||
|
||||
Please note that the data may appear to be reordered as part of this
|
||||
operation. This is because updated rows will be deleted from the
|
||||
dataset and then reinserted at the end with the new values.
|
||||
|
||||
Parameters
|
||||
----------
|
||||
|
||||
on: Union[str, Iterable[str]]
|
||||
A column (or columns) to join on. This is how records from the
|
||||
source table and target table are matched. Typically this is some
|
||||
kind of key or id column.
|
||||
|
||||
Examples
|
||||
--------
|
||||
>>> import lancedb
|
||||
>>> data = pa.table({"a": [2, 1, 3], "b": ["a", "b", "c"]})
|
||||
>>> db = lancedb.connect("./.lancedb")
|
||||
>>> table = db.create_table("my_table", data)
|
||||
>>> new_data = pa.table({"a": [2, 3, 4], "b": ["x", "y", "z"]})
|
||||
>>> # Perform a "upsert" operation
|
||||
>>> table.merge_insert("a") \\
|
||||
... .when_matched_update_all() \\
|
||||
... .when_not_matched_insert_all() \\
|
||||
... .execute(new_data)
|
||||
>>> # The order of new rows is non-deterministic since we use
|
||||
>>> # a hash-join as part of this operation and so we sort here
|
||||
>>> table.to_arrow().sort_by("a").to_pandas()
|
||||
a b
|
||||
0 1 b
|
||||
1 2 x
|
||||
2 3 y
|
||||
3 4 z
|
||||
"""
